Hi,
I am trying to import a few of the pcf/ccf's that I found online here at remote central to my TSU3000. The import is working except that it doesn't import the pages under system. So I end up with the person's design but with the pronto's default header/footer from system page.
I believe I am working with the latest version firmware/prontoedit. The versions are:
Pronto TSU3000 v3.0 Application version: App 3.1.15 Database Version: v2.53U Boot Loader version: V2.35b Free mem: 88% Pronto Edit: V2.0.9.0
The ccf I am trying to import is "Daniel's B&W Pronto Configuration" dated March 20, 2001. However, this problem appears on all ccf files I have tried so far.
The problem seems limited to ccf as I imported a pcf file and the system pages were successfully imported.
Can someone help me.
Thanks

CCFs do not have a system page. So you will always end up with the default System Page when importing a CCF. You will need to edit the system page if you don't like it.

The Pronto has no system page.
If you import a CCF, simply delete all the items on the system page except maybe time/date if you don't want it to show. If you'd like to see what the standard Pronto display looks like, you should download ProntoEdit and emulate the CCF.
